    About the producer

    Vincent Girardin comes from a family that has cultivated vines since the 17th century. But the real history of Domaine Vincent Girardin is recent, since it began in 1980 when Vincent Girardin took back the two hectares of vines from his parents (the family have been wine growers since the 17th century) to produce his own wine. He produces wines from environmentally-friendly vineyards (no herbicides or insecticides, natural compost and from local farms, manual harvesting), and in a very natural way. The vineyard now covers 20 hectares, spread over 42 plots, and produces wines from prestigious appellations in the Côte de Beaune (Meursault, Puligny Montrachet, Chassagne Montrachet, Saint Aubin, Santenay, Savigny Les Beaune, Aloxe Corton, Volnay and Pommard). Vincent Girardin had taken his Burgundy trading house to the top since it was founded in 1992. Bought by the Compagnie des Vins d'Autrefois in 2012, the technical team however remained the same, led by Eric Germain from Meursault. The selection of winemakers remains demanding, as is the high quality of the wines. The red wines are supple, fruity and elegant, whilst the whites are fine, pure, bold and lively.

    About the wine

    Relatively light in colour, this wine turns out to be incredibly elegant, floral and fruity. It is delicate on the palate with a very carefully measured hint of bitterness in the finish. A remarkable Grand Cru.
